10 Simple Craft Projects Under $10
1. This decoupage floral planter
This is truly an easy DIY for all the flowers in your life.
You just need clay pots and napkins or scrap paper.

3. How to make a bird plate wall
This is such an easy project and you could make it with any set of plates.
And any pattern.
It doesn’t have to be birds. You can shop the craft store for different designs and make this plate wall to match your decor.

5. This faux chair slipcover
Isn’t this fun?
It would be such a fun project for a craft room or office or party.
The project is made with a pre-made slicover and iron-on fabric adhesive.

6. Book page garland
All you need for this project?
String and book pages and then you can decorate with it anywhere that you would use wood beads.
Toss it over a stack of books. Add it to a basket. Decorate your coffee table with it.
